I need to ask what XA1102 in the design institute specifically means. Here, XA is commonly used to indicate a pump fault alarm, while XL indicates that the pump is operating. This design is quite imperfect; as can be seen from this diagram, the pump is not controlled via frequency conversion. There is an interlock relationship between the LIS1102 and the pump, but this interlock relationship is not indicated (it is not clear whether it is an interlock based on high liquid level, low liquid level, or both).
What is meant is to stop the pump when the liquid level in the storage tank is very low; the level transmitter sends a signal to the interlock circuit, which then sends this signal to the pump’s motor. It’s not common to combine this signal with the pump failure alarm signal in the diagram. We also often use XA to represent motor fault signals in our diagrams.
